Transaction 3770c52f7480cddb7428b6b6040582fae0bf987c9577fc26bf59093e0c44e691

6 Input
2 Outputs
  • 3770c52f7480cddb7428b6b6040582fae0bf987c9577fc26bf59093e0c44e691:0
  • value  15739
    address  1EehnH4LJundVYdhSWrAhQragFUj5g7rSy
  • 3770c52f7480cddb7428b6b6040582fae0bf987c9577fc26bf59093e0c44e691:1
  • value  1480127
    address  3PsPdjYWXX19rvugFxnRqv8zwKSDqpPcT2